ScienceOnline2012 – interview with Matthew Francis

Every year I ask some of the attendees of the ScienceOnline conferences to tell me (and my readers) more about themselves, their careers, current projects and their views on the use of the Web in science, science education or science communication. So now we continue with the participants of ScienceOnline2012. See all the interviews in this series here.

Today my guest is Matthew Francis (blog, Twitter).

Welcome to A Blog Around The Clock. Would you, please, tell my readers a little bit more about yourself?

”]”]I’m a physicist, freelance science writer, former college professor, ex-planetarium director, and wearer of jaunty hats. (And yes, that’s part of my standard biography.) I hold a Ph.D. in physics and astronomy from Rutgers University, and my undergraduate degree is from Central College, a small liberal arts college in Iowa. While I majored in physics, my minors were in math and English.

Tell us a little more about your career trajectory so far: interesting projects past and present?

As you can tell from the “former” and “ex-” in the paragraph above, my career has followed an unpredictable trajectory. I fully expected to retire from teaching at a college, but when my university faced serious financial troubles, they decided to eliminate the physics department. However, I’ve always loved writing, so I decided to see if losing my job could be turned into an opportunity. In my last year of teaching, I began a blog, “Galileo’s Pendulum“, and in the last six months started writing a book. I am also contributing physics editor for “Double X Science“, a blog aimed at providing good science content for and about women.

“Galileo’s Pendulum” covers a variety of topics in physics, astronomy, and related fields, mostly for non-scientists. I try to mix some lessons about how science works in practice into my writing as much as possible, since it’s an area of common misconceptions. In particular, as a theoretical physicist, I try to emphasize the importance of evidence in all aspects of science, since it’s too commonly assumed that coming up with “theories” is a matter of sitting alone in a room and thinking hard. Real science is far messier and more glorious than that – and there’s romance even in the messiness.

A similar theme plays in my book-in-progress, which is tentatively titled Back Roads, Dark Skies: a Cosmological Journey. For this book, I am traveling to various observatories and labs across the United States where the real work of cosmology is done, meeting scientists and viewing the equipment they use. Cosmology is big science: many projects involve hundreds of researchers, and the ways they go about learning about the Universe are as important as their discoveries. After all, the most important question one can ask in science is, “How do we know?”

What aspect of science communication and/or particular use of the Web in science interests you the most?

I still think of myself as an educator even now, though I’m no longer in the college classroom. I want to share the wonder of physics to those who think of it as something beyond them, or even something to fear. In this era when the very goals of education are being challenged (at least for the children of poor and working-class families), it seems more important than ever to stress the importance of science, not just in daily lives, but in our intellectual structure. Science can be a source of joy and wonder for everyone, whether they are scientists or not.

The Web and social networking allow me to connect with those who are truly interested in finding what I write. My audience isn’t huge, but it’s pretty diverse: I have people from Iran and clergy from Wisconsin, a few kids, and even a handful of professional physicists among my readers. I don’t think that would even be possible without the Web. Twitter is really my community, since I haven’t identified any other professional science writers in Richmond (yet at least). My best professional contacts in the last two years have come through Twitter, including the entire ScienceOnline community.

After some years on Usenet newsgroups, commenting on other people’s blogs, writing diaries on campaign blogs and places like DailyKos, I finally started my own first blog on this date in 2004. Compared to a bunch of my friends, eight years of blogging makes me a relative new-comer. But I understand how eight years might seem like eternity to those who just started.

Eight years is sufficient time for a blog (and blogger) to undergo quite a lot of changes. I started out writing about politics. Moved to science later. Now I split my time about halfway between science communication (and other thoughts on the media) and science itself. My blog split into three blogs in early 2005, then re-fused back into a single blog – and got a new name, “A Blog Around The Clock” – in June of 2006, when I joined Scienceblogs.com. After #PepsiGate in summer 2010, I moved the blog to WordPress, and, once we launched here at Scientific American, the blog moved here as well. And while this is still my personal blog for my own musings, I tend to spend much more time managing the network, editing posts for Guest Blog, Expeditions and The SA Incubator, and using other outlets, online and offline, to promote science, science communication, and more.

Blogging did a lot for me – I now have a big online and offline community, lots of friends, invitations to travel, and I got two jobs (including this one) directly due to my blogging. I still do not understand exactly why – I never suffered from Impostor Syndrome during my ten years in research, but have it badly as a writer, blogger and editor. Still bewildered that people take time to read my 40,000-word screeds! But thank you all for doing it, for whatever reason you do. And thank you for supporting me all these years – it’s now time for payback (or is that ‘pay-forward’), welcoming new people to the community, promoting new bloggers and writers, helping other people succeed. An example of why it is important to distinguish evolution as fact, theory, and path. by T. Ryan Gregory:

I, and others, have pointed out that there are three aspects of evolution: evolution as fact, evolution as theory, and evolution as path. Evolution as fact refers to the historical reality that species are related through common ancestry. This is supported by a massive amount of evidence from a wide array of independent sources. Evolution as theory refers to the proposed explanations for how “descent with modification” occurs — mutation, natural selection, genetic drift, etc. Evolution as path refers to the actual patterns that have occurred during the history of life, such as when certain events (e.g., branching points, extinctions, etc.) took place, how lineages are related, when and how many times certain traits evolved, and such. The important point is that these three components are largely independent…

ScienceOnline2012 – interview with Helen Chappell

Every year I ask some of the attendees of the ScienceOnline conferences to tell me (and my readers) more about themselves, their careers, current projects and their views on the use of the Web in science, science education or science communication. So now we continue with the participants of ScienceOnline2012. See all the interviews in this series here.

Today my guest is Helen Chappell (Twitter).

Welcome to A Blog Around The Clock. Would you, please, tell my readers a little bit more about yourself? Where are you coming from (both geographically and philosophically)? What is your background? Any scientific education?

I’m a recovering physicist from North Carolina, and I recently returned to the Old North State after three years’ exile at a Colorado grad school studying nanocrystalline solar materials. Turns out I’m too much of a generalist at heart to be happy doing physics research, so I escaped into science journalism in 2011 via the AAAS Mass Media Fellowship Program (highly recommended for any would-be science journalists out there doing research). I also have a background in informal education — I used to give star talks and develop summer camps, among other things, at a planetarium — so I’ve ended up sort of floating around between research, education, and writing circles. That meant ScienceOnline was right up my alley. I wish I’d heard about it before last year!

Tell us a little more about your career trajectory so far: interesting projects past and present?

As of this spring, I’m an exhibit developer at the N.C. Museum of Natural Sciences. My path has been informal education -> astronomy research -> materials science research -> chemical physics research -> science journalism -> informal education. Lots of meandering to end up almost in the same place, I suppose, but exhibit development is an amazing fit for me so far. It has a lot of the variety of journalism with less pressure, and there’s time to really pay attention to your craft. I also get to work closely with scientists, so my research background is a huge help.

I’m also trying to keep my foot wedged in the door of the writing world, by doing a tiny bit of freelance work here and there (I had a recent piece for Discover), blogging for work at the N.C. Museum of Natural Sciences Exhibits Blog, and blogging for play at B-Scides.

I’m really enjoying building the exhibits blog at the museum. I’m always fascinated by “the making of” pretty much anything. Taking folks behind the scenes of the exhibits is my excuse to geek out about what I do — and since I’m new to exhibit development, I’m also learning a lot along the way. If you have a question for us about how exhibits are made, email me or tweet it with the hashtag #AskAnExhibitionist, and I’ll blog the answers.

What is taking up the most of your time and passion these days? What are your goals?

I’m still figuring out long-term goals, though I expect I’ll be happy doing exhibit development for a good long while. I’m investing a lot of energy into figuring out how to get better at what I do, since it’s brand new for me. II’m still enough of a scientist to geek out about literature searches, and the literature about museum visitor behavior and visitor-oriented design strategies is completely new to me, so there’s a lot to geek out about.

What aspect of science communication and/or particular use of the Web in science interests you the most?

Something I’ve spent a lot of my time thinking about recently is how to use the web and mobile technology to expand the museum experience beyond exhibits and programs (or really any experience). We’ve dabbled with QR codes in a few places, but it’s definitely still an experiment, and we’ve yet to figure out what works best. Using mobile technology in the exhibits can be a sticky issue, though, because not everyone can get — or even wants — a smartphone (like me, for instance). Especially as we’re an accredited state museum, universal accessibility (or the closest we can get) is key. I’d love for us to have a modern-day, mobile-driven version of the audioguide tour with video and interactive content, but it’ll be a huge challenge keeping it accessible.

How does (if it does) blogging figure in your work? How about social networks, e.g., Twitter, Google Plus and Facebook? Do you find all this online activity to be a net positive (or even a necessity) in what you do?

In the exhibits group at the museum, we use blogging as a way to give folks a behind-the-scenes tour. As a writer, I use blogging mostly as a place to get some practice in, and get my fix for writing about things I think are cool without jumping through all the editorial hoops at a polished publication. Blogging is definitely a net positive for me.

Social networks, though, I’m less active in. I’m on a bunch of them, but I mostly use them as a place for folks to find me if they need to, and as a way to keep my finger on the pulse of the online science world when I’m looking to catch up or get a distraction. They’re probably a slight net positive, or else I wouldn’t be using them, right? I hope that’s true, at least.

What was the best aspect of ScienceOnline2012 for you? Any suggestions for next year? Is there anything that happened at this Conference – a session, something someone said or did or wrote – that will change the way you think about science communication, or something that you will take with you to your job, blog-reading and blog-writing?

The best aspect of ScienceOnline for me was definitely the social one — it’s not often you get to share space with 450 of the most creative, talented, and wacky folks around, all of whom share interests with you. It was the most freely-mixing conference I’ve ever been to, where established top dogs and newbies mingled easily, unlike at so many stratified science meetings. The social aspect outlasts the actual conference, too, and I’ve kept up with lots of folks I met online and even in person (especially since I’m a local).

Perhaps my strongest takeaway, though, was the #iamscience project. Having left research fairly recently, I was struggling with losing my identity as a scientist. The #iamscience project made me feel like I was in excellent company. I’m still a scientist, just not a research scientist, and that’s awesome.

ScienceOnline2012 – interview with Samuel Arbesman

Every year I ask some of the attendees of the ScienceOnline conferences to tell me (and my readers) more about themselves, their careers, current projects and their views on the use of the Web in science, science education or science communication. So now we continue with the participants of ScienceOnline2012. See all the interviews in this series here.

Today my guest is Samuel Arbesman (Twitter).

Welcome to A Blog Around The Clock. Would you, please, tell my readers a little bit more about yourself? Where are you coming from (both geographically and philosophically)? What is your background? Any scientific education?

I’m an applied mathematician and am currently a Senior Scholar at the Kauffman Foundation, based in Kansas City.

I grew up in Buffalo and went to Brandeis University in the Boston suburbs for my undergraduate degree, where I studied biology and computer science. Continuing this path, I got a PhD at Cornell in computational biology and then went back to Boston for a postdoc at Harvard, where I studied network science and computational sociology.

Alongside all of this, I began writing for popular audiences about science. I just finished my first book, The Half-Life of Facts, which will be published at the end of September.

Tell us a little more about your career trajectory so far: interesting projects past and present?

My career has been rather strange and at the interstitial parts of the sciences.

Soon after I began my PhD at Cornell, I realized that while I enjoyed the mathematical and computational models of biology, I wanted to use these models to understand social systems. I moved more into understanding network science and how people interact and collaborate, especially when it comes to scientific progress.

Happily, my committee was very supportive of this shift and allowed me to do some highly interdisciplinary research, even including some applied mathematical analysis of baseball hitting streaks.

After finishing graduate school, I continued in a postdoc where I had the opportunity to continue doing network science research, as well as applied math work into collaboration and scientific progress more generally.

In parallel, I had been slowly nurturing my writing hobby. I got a first taste of this when I wrote about my baseball research with my grad school adviser Steve Strogatz in the New York Times. After moving to Boston, I began writing for the Ideas section of the Boston Globe. Ideas is one of those amazing sections of the paper that don’t really exist anywhere else, but is enormously important. As lucky as I’ve been in my academic career to be given the freedom to play with lots of different topics, Ideas gave me the freedom to play with a lot of crazy ideas as well (everything from how to name a scientific constant to fantasy geopolitics). Lastly, they gave me the space to write a short essay about the pace at which facts change around us, and coin the term mesofact.

This essay gave way to the book that is being published at the end of September, The Half-Life of Facts, which I am really excited about and is a fun repository of all the disparate knowledge I have lodged in my brain.

Due to my interdisciplinary research and my interest in writing for popular audiences, I knew that I would not fit particularly well in traditional academia. While I conducted the traditional job search at the conclusion of my postdoc, I was extremely excited when the Kauffman Foundation – a private foundation devoted to entrepreneurship, innovation, and education – approached me about joining as a Senior Scholar. At Kauffman I was given the opportunity to pursue my interdisciplinary research unhindered by departmental boundaries, do loads of popular writing, and in general indulge my interests. I jumped at the opportunity and as I start my second year here, I am very happy with my decision.

Since joining the Kauffman Foundation, I have worked on understanding cities and how they are related to innovation and science. I am also involved with trying to understand the future of science, tied in with understanding how knowledge changes more generally.

What is taking up the most of your time and passion these days? What are your goals?

The biggest project right is now my book, which is devoted to the science behind how knowledge changes. But more generally related to how knowledge works, I am focusing on the future of science, and trying to understand the types of institutions that we need in order to foster the types of activities that are truly valuable for science.

In addition, I am continuing my work on cities and innovation, from an applied mathematics perspective.

How does (if it does) blogging figure in your work? How about social networks, e.g., Twitter, Google Plus and Facebook? Do you find all this online activity to be a net positive (or even a necessity) in what you do?

Blogging is a big portion of my work. My job at Kauffman involves spreading ideas, exploring various concepts and topics, and representing the Kauffman Foundation. Kauffman is very supportive of my blogging at Wired, as well as my use of Twitter and other social media. All of these connect me with a great and varied community, and allow me to maintain a network of colleagues.

ScienceOnline2012 – interview with Adrian Down

Every year I ask some of the attendees of the ScienceOnline conferences to tell me (and my readers) more about themselves, their careers, current projects and their views on the use of the Web in science, science education or science communication. So now we continue with the participants of ScienceOnline2012. See all the interviews in this series here.

Today my guest is Adrian Down.

Welcome to A Blog Around The Clock. Would you, please, tell my readers a little bit more about yourself? Where are you coming from (both geographically and philosophically)? What is your background? Tell us a little more about your career trajectory so far: interesting projects past and present?

If you asked me five years ago where I’d be today, my predictions would come nowhere close to the truth.  I’m currently a graduate student at Duke University getting a Ph.D. in ecology.  Five years ago, I was farming in the jungles of Hawaii.  I had just spent four years in California getting bachelors degrees in physics and mathematics from UC Berkeley.  All I knew at the time was that my experiences teaching and working with plants provided more fulfillment than a career as a physicist seemed to promise.  It was my passion for plants that led me to Hawaii’s Big Island.

With no electricity to power a computer and the nearest approximation of night life 20 miles of rutted gravel road away, I had a lot of time to read and think once the sun went down in the jungle.  The longer I spent farming, the more I thought about data.  If we knew which plants were performing best in what conditions, we could optimize farm design, create thriving hybrid agricultural and natural ecosystems.  The farm was my lab, and I wanted numbers to crunch.  It was then that I realized I am a terminal scientist.  For some of us, you can take the scientist out of the lab, but you can’t take the scientific method out of the scientist.  When I decided to come back to academia, ecology was an obvious choice, given my fascination with the continuum between natural and agricultural ecosystems in Hawaii.

I went back to school to study sustainable agriculture.  These days, I study methane.  Specifically, I’m developing techniques to “fingerprint” methane sources.  If you’ve got high methane concentrations and you want to know where that methane is coming from, I can help you.  There are a lot of sources of methane to the atmosphere, including wetlands, cows and other ruminants, landfills, and leaks in natural gas infrastructure.  Methane is a powerful greenhouse gas, so a comparatively small reduction in methane emissions can have a large climate change benefit.  Understanding where methane is coming from is an important step in reducing emissions.

My transition from agro-eocology to biogeochemistry wasn’t because of cows’ prodigious methane production.  I got involved with methane because my Ph.D. advisor, Rob Jackson, started researching hydraulic fracturing, or “fracking”, a relatively new technique for extracting natural gas from deep in the Earth.  There are a number of things that swayed me to my current course of study.  In the course of my current degree, I’m learning a variety of tools and lab techniques that are broadly applicable to a number of systems.  I think (or maybe I should say, “I hope” ) there are ways to apply some of these same techniques in a more agricultural context in the future.  I also get to do research that can have immediate and positive impact on policy and, ultimately, both climate change and human health.  The United States is experiencing a once-in-a-generation transition in our energy source from coal to natural gas, and it’s exciting to be on the cutting edge of research in that area.

What aspect of science communication and/or particular use of the Web in science interests you the most?

Working in the context of a contentious issue like fracking means that communication is an essential part of what we do in my research group.  I’ve been interested in scientific communication ever since I started working with high school students in Oakland and San Francisco while at UC Berkeley.  Teaching has been a passion of mine ever since I got my feet wet in college, and I used to relish the challenge of communicating complex ideas from physics in a clear and engaging way.  Physics needs communicators because its a field many see as intimidatingly complex and frighteningly difficult.  Now, I work on a topic that is socially, rather than mathematically, complex and can be frighteningly contentiousness.  For some, this would be a nightmare, but for me, I take it as part of my training as a scientist.  I don’t know yet what I want to do with my Ph.D., but I hope that my future career is centered around scientific communication in some form or another.

We are in the unique position that we have to do most of our communicating and explaining to the general public, rather than to other scientists.  The web is absolutely essential in this regard.  Almost all of the discussion of fracking, including our science, takes place online.  As with many contentious issues, some people seek out information that supports their point of view and ignore other information.  I have seen research from our group be interpreted in diametrically opposed ways by people with different opinions.

Seeing the varying reactions to our research has left me with some lasting lessons in science communication.  The first is that simply putting science in the public domain is not enough.  Without some knowledgable interpretation, its very easy for scientific conclusions to be misunderstood or taken out of context.  The second is that we as scientists can no longer rely solely upon the news media to convey our findings or their meaning to the public.  We need to engage more directly with new media, such as blogs and social media, if we want to have any hope of staying relevant to the public.  These are the means by which people are increasingly acquiring information and forming opinions.

How does (if it does) blogging figure in your work?

On a personal level, science blogs are how I keep up with the world of science.  As a confirmed science nerd and inveterate triviaphile, I read widely outside my field.  A good science blog post, at least for my tastes, explains results and conclusions with added context and without the jargon that can make reading outside my field challenging.  I scan a number of science blog feeds and read in the neighborhood of five to ten posts daily.

What was the best aspect of ScienceOnline2012 for you? Any suggestions for next year? Is there anything that happened at this Conference – a session, something someone said or did or wrote – that will change the way you think about science communication, or something that you will take with you to your job, blog-reading and blog-writing?

ScienceOnline 2012 was a valuable experience for me.  I got to meet with some of the people behind the blogs I enjoy and whose writing I admire, like Ed Yong.  Through the workshops, I learned some of their techniques to their success.  It was interesting to me to notice the distinctive culture of science writing, which is different than that of academic science.  As a scientist interested in communication with the public, and with science bloggers as one mediator of that conversation, its helpful for me to understand the differences between the professional cultures of these two professions.  Understanding one’s audience can lead to better communication, even when the audience isn’t the public directly.

The one thing that I would like to see more of at future conferences is interaction between scientists, science writers, and educators who could make use of science blogs as a part of science education curricula.  I think science blogs and social media can bring science to younger students in a way that is more intuitive to how they are used to interacting with news and information.  People who realize they can follow scientific discoveries without an advanced science background are potentially more apt to stay engaged with and value science as a form of inquiry.  Science literacy and the ability to interpret claims based on scientific data are hugely important to an informed public discourse.  Science blogs are one avenue for members of the public to stay informed and thereby be better equipped to evaluate how science is used by non-scientists to promote ideas or make policy decisions.  Getting scientists, science writers, and educators together can help improve the process of getting engaging science to the public, especially students, who need scientific literacy now more than ever.
